Who is Virat Kohli?

  • Status: Cricketer, Former Captain of the Indian Cricket Team
  • Born: November 5, 1988 (Age: 35 as of 2023)
  • Country of Birth: India
  • Countries Worked: Virat Kohli has worked extensively in international cricket, representing India in various countries around the world. He has played in numerous international cricket venues, like Australia, England, South Africa, New Zealand, West Indies, & Sri Lanka, among others. He has also played in domestic leagues such as the Indian Premier League (IPL).

How Virat Kohli Maintains Health & Wellness?

Virat Kohli is known for his dedication to health and fitness. He follows a strict fitness regime that includes a combination of strength training, cardiovascular exercises, and functional training. Kohli has also adopted yoga and meditation into his routine to enhance his mental well-being and focus. He follows a plant-based diet, which he credits for improving his energy levels, stamina, and overall fitness.

Kohli’s wellness practices are holistic, with a heavy emphasis on yoga, mindfulness, and meditation, all of which help him stay calm under pressure, both on and off the field. His diet is predominantly vegan, focusing on consuming whole foods that are rich in nutrients, which he claims has transformed his body, reduced inflammation, and improved his overall performance.

Virat Kohli and Wellness Natural Therapies

Reason for Adopting These Therapies:

Virat Kohli did not suffer from a specific disease, but his increasing awareness about maintaining long-term health, combined with the physical demands of professional cricket, led him to explore wellness therapies. Over time, Kohli embraced yoga, meditation, and a vegan diet to enhance his fitness and mental sharpness. His shift to a plant-based diet was driven by his desire to improve his performance, recover faster from injuries, and sustain a high level of physical output.

He has emphasized how yoga and meditation have helped him with mental clarity, focus, and stress management, particularly when dealing with high-pressure situations on the field.

Outcome:

Kohli’s adoption of these wellness therapies has had a significant impact on his performance as an athlete. His physical transformation is evident in his agility, stamina, and endurance. His shift to a vegan diet helped him shed extra weight and increase muscle tone, while yoga and meditation helped him manage stress and improve concentration during matches. Kohli has stated that these practices have prolonged his career, allowing him to stay at the top of his game well into his 30s.

The Status

Fame:

Virat Kohli is one of the most famous and accomplished cricketers in the world. He is widely recognized for his outstanding performances in international cricket, leading the Indian cricket team as captain from 2013 to 2021. He is known for his batting prowess, breaking numerous records, including being one of the fastest players to score 10,000 ODI runs and 71 international centuries. Kohli has achieved global fame for his aggressive and passionate style of play, making him a cricketing icon across the world.

Awards:

  • Rajiv Gandhi Khel Ratna Award (2018) – India’s highest sporting honor
  • Padma Shri (2017) – India’s fourth-highest civilian award
  • Sir Garfield Sobers Trophy – ICC Cricketer of the Year (2017 and 2018)
  • Arjuna Award (2013)
  • Numerous ICC Player of the Year and BCCI awards

What Virat Kohli Contributed to the Society?

Social Contributions:

Virat Kohli is actively involved in charity and philanthropy through his foundation, the Virat Kohli Foundation, which focuses on supporting underprivileged children, providing sports scholarships, and helping young athletes pursue their dreams. He has also been a strong advocate for animal welfare, particularly after adopting a vegan lifestyle, and has worked with various organizations to promote plant-based diets for environmental and health reasons.

Cultural Contributions:

Kohli has made a significant impact on India’s sporting culture, inspiring a new generation of cricketers to focus not only on skill but also on physical fitness, mental health, and discipline. His fitness transformation has set new standards for athletes in Indian cricket and other sports, encouraging a cultural shift toward healthier lifestyles and sustainable diets.

Political Contributions:

While Kohli has stayed away from politics, he has used his social media platforms to promote messages of unity, peace, and non-violence. During difficult times, including social unrest in India, he has urged his followers to stay united and respect one another.

Mental Health Advocacy:

Kohli has also spoken about the importance of mental health, especially for athletes facing high levels of stress and pressure. He has promoted mental well-being through meditation, yoga, and mindfulness, encouraging people to prioritize mental health just as much as physical health. Kohli has frequently shared how his mental clarity on the field comes from his regular practice of these wellness therapies.

Philanthropy:

In addition to his foundation’s efforts, Virat Kohli is involved in various charitable causes and has contributed to COVID-19 relief efforts in India. He and his wife, actress Anushka Sharma, have donated to multiple causes, including raising funds for pandemic relief and supporting marginalized communities affected by the crisis.
